One of the ways is by depositing the money to the accounts of the employees’. This method involves withdrawing the money and then you pay your employees to their accounts. When you pay your staff directly from your account, you will always pay the amount that is needed to the employees and that is good for the sake of peace in your company. Complaints are not good for they waste a lot of time and also trust which can ruin your company.
The cheque is another method of making payment of salaries. An alternative method of paying salaries is by giving employees cheque. Even though this method is used, it has some setbacks such that as an employer you might risk losing the cheque as you take the cheque to the employee. Another thing you need to know about the chaque is that this service may not be very reliable if you want to have the business account updated.
Cash payment is also another way to pay your staff. If the employees are not many, this method could favor you but in case the employees are numerous the method becomes unreliable. Paying by cash is also a method that is not allowed since when you do so it means that the deductions are not made and it’s a requirement for the employees to pay taxes and other deductions.
